Going by what the Unofficial Guide to WDW says, at the Boardwalk Villas, you're getting a location near to many other resorts & restaurants and even walking distance to two of the 4 main parks, and I think the studios are the largest out of any of the DVC studios, but you're also in a busier, noisier resort area that could hamper any romantic vibe.
With the Wilderness Lodge Villas, it's a little more secluded (which *I* would find more romantic), you get ferry service to the MK, depending on the time of year you may even have ferry service to the Contemporary which would give you monorail access, and a brief walk or bus ride to Fort Wilderness and all there is to offer there (Hoop De Do, romantic carriage or hay rides, campfires and movies under the stars, granted, they're Disney movies but I always like outdoor movies, myself).
If it weren't a honeymoon, I might be more tempted to do the Boardwalk between those two DVC options. But for the more serene locale alone, I'd do Wilderness in a heartbeat. I'd even consider OKW & SSR before Boardwalk for a honeymoon. They're both more spread out, more secluded, but with ferry access to DTD & Pleasure Island. SSR even has a walkway to the DTD on both ends, and I've heard OKW has a walkway now, as well, don't know if that's definite or not. So you're reasonably close to some night life options without being right on top of them, literally.
